What is a 2007 Chevy Silverado Fuel Pump Wiring Diagram and How It's Your Best Friend
At its core, a 2007 Chevy Silverado Fuel Pump Wiring Diagram is a schematic illustration that maps out the electrical pathways connecting the fuel pump to the rest of your truck's electrical system. Think of it as a road map for electricity, showing where the power comes from, where it goes, and how the fuel pump is instructed to operate. This diagram is absolutely essential for anyone looking to understand the intricacies of fuel delivery. Without it, troubleshooting becomes a guessing game, potentially leading to incorrect repairs and further complications.
These diagrams are incredibly useful for a variety of tasks, especially when dealing with a no-start condition or intermittent fuel delivery problems. Technicians and DIY enthusiasts alike rely on them to:
- Identify the location of key components like the fuel pump relay, inertia fuel cutoff switch (if equipped), and fuses.
- Trace the flow of power to the fuel pump.
- Understand the voltage and amperage requirements for the fuel pump circuit.
- Diagnose faulty wiring, corroded connectors, or blown fuses.
The diagram provides a visual representation of how the truck's computer (ECU or PCM) communicates with the fuel pump. This communication is crucial for regulating fuel pressure and ensuring your engine receives the correct amount of fuel under all operating conditions. Here's a simplified look at the typical flow represented in a 2007 Chevy Silverado Fuel Pump Wiring Diagram:
| Component | Function |
|---|---|
| Battery | Provides electrical power. |
| Ignition Switch | Activates the fuel pump circuit when the key is turned. |
| Fuel Pump Relay | Acts as a switch, controlled by the ECU, to send power to the pump. |
| Inertia Fuel Cutoff Switch (if equipped) | A safety device that cuts power to the fuel pump in case of an impact. |
| Fuel Pump Motor | The component that draws fuel from the tank and pressurizes it. |
| Ground Wire | Completes the electrical circuit, returning power to the battery. |
